#f6dec1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f6dec1 is composed of 96.5% red, 87.1%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 9.8% magenta, 21.5%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 32.8 degrees, a saturation of 74.6% and a lightness of 86.1%. #f6dec1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#edbd83. Closest websafe color is: #ffcccc.

Shades and Tints of #f6dec1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070401 is the darkest color, while #fdf9f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f6dec1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#dddcda is the less saturated color, while #fedfb9 is the most saturated one.
